The global export landscape of animal feed preparations reveals significant variations by country. The Netherlands leads with 3.22 billion kilograms, followed by Germany (2.0045) and Belgium (1.8879). The United States and China also hold prominent positions. Notable year-on-year increases include Greece at 11.65%, Macedonia at 31.72%, and Palestine at 56.49%. Conversely, Canada, Argentina, and the Philippines experienced declines.

Top countries in Export of Animal Feed Preparations by Country
| # | 10 Countries | Kilograms | Last Year | YoY | 5-years CAGR | |
|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|
| 1 | 1 Netherlands | 3,220,000,000 | 2023 | +1.02% | +1.14% | View data |
| 2 | 2 Germany | 2,004,500,000 | 2023 | +0.94% | +1.27% | View data |
| 3 | 3 Belgium | 1,887,900,000 | 2023 | +2.21% | +2.56% | View data |
| 4 | 4 United States | 1,574,800,000 | 2023 | +1.67% | +1.68% | View data |
| 5 | 5 China | 1,408,600,000 | 2023 | +3.33% | +3.35% | View data |
| 6 | 6 Italy | 765,410,000 | 2023 | +4.77% | +5.04% | View data |
| 7 | 7 France | 720,940,000 | 2023 | -0.5% | +1.89% | View data |
| 8 | 8 Spain | 622,840,000 | 2023 | +3.09% | +3.14% | View data |
| 9 | 9 United Kingdom | 611,090,000 | 2023 | +2.32% | +2.33% | View data |
| 10 | 10 Austria | 469,540,000 | 2023 | +3.93% | +3.89% | View data |
